Highest Education Level

Analysts in Northford, CT off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
42.1%
Master's Degree
30.6%
Associate's Degree
7.7%
High School or GED
7.2%
Vocational Degree or Certification
6.8%
Doctorate Degree
4.7%
Some College
0.7%
Some High School
0.2%
